Skip to content

HuiNeng6/rustchain-vscode-extension

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

RustChain VS Code Extension

VS Code extension for RustChain wallet balance, miner status, and bounty board.

Bounty #2868 - 30 RTC

Features

  • Wallet Balance - Shows RTC balance in sidebar
  • Miner Status - Green/red indicator for miner attestation
  • Bounty Browser - Browse open bounties from rustchain-bounties
  • Epoch Timer - Countdown to next epoch settlement
  • Quick Actions - "Claim Bounty" button opens PR template

Installation

From VS Code Marketplace

Search "RustChain Dashboard" in Extensions

From Source

npm install
npm run compile

Configuration

Settings (VS Code → Settings → RustChain):

Setting Default Description
rustchain.wallet "" Your RTC wallet address
rustchain.nodeUrl https://rustchain.org RustChain node URL
rustchain.refreshInterval 60000 Refresh interval (ms)

Commands

Command Description
RustChain: Refresh Refresh all data
RustChain: Open Bounty Open bounty in browser
RustChain: Copy Wallet Copy wallet address
RustChain: Open Claim Template Open bounty claim template

Sidebar Views

  1. Wallet - Balance + wallet address
  2. Miner Status - Active/inactive indicator
  3. Bounty Board - Top 10 open bounties
  4. Epoch Timer - Current epoch info

Works With

  • VS Code
  • Cursor
  • Windsurf

Bounty Claim

License

MIT

About

VS Code extension for RustChain wallet balance, miner status, and bounty board

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ors